Print

Spinach Garlic Mozzarella Stuffed Meatballs

5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

Tender and flavorful, these spinach garlic mozzarella stuffed meatballs feature a gooey cheesy center, nutritious spinach, and aromatic herbs. They’re perfect for family dinners, entertaining, or weeknight meals.

  • Author: Sophia
  • Prep Time: 20 minutes
  • Cook Time: 15 minutes
  • Total Time: 35 minutes
  • Yield: 4 servings (16–18 meatballs)
  • Category: Main Dish
  • Method: Stovetop
  • Cuisine: Italian
  • Diet: Halal

Ingredients

  • 450 g ground beef
  • 1 cup fresh spinach, finely chopped
  • 3 cloves garlic, minced
  • 60 ml breadcrumbs
  • 25 g freshly grated Parmesan cheese
  • 1 large egg
  • 1/2 teaspoon fine salt
  • 1/4 teaspoon ground black pepper
  • 1/2 teaspoon Italian seasoning
  • 1 cup mozzarella cheese, cut into small cubes
  • 2 tablespoons olive oil

Instructions

  1. In a large bowl, combine ground beef, spinach, garlic, breadcrumbs, Parmesan, egg, salt, pepper, and Italian seasoning. Mix gently until just combined.
  2. Scoop 1–2 tablespoons of the mixture and flatten in your palm. Place a mozzarella cube in the center, then wrap the meat around it and roll into a smooth ball. Repeat with remaining mixture.
  3. Heat olive oil in a large skillet over medium heat. Add meatballs in batches, ensuring they’re not overcrowded. Cook for 4–5 minutes per side until browned and cooked through.
  4. Serve hot with marinara sauce, over pasta, in sandwiches, or on their own. Garnish with fresh herbs or extra Parmesan if desired.

Notes

  • Ensure mozzarella is fully sealed within the meat to prevent leaks.
  • Mix meat gently to avoid tough meatballs.
  • Use a food processor to finely chop spinach if needed.
  • Can be baked at 400°F (200°C) for 20–25 minutes as an alternative to frying.

Nutrition